How Structural Drying Actually Works

When water gets into your home’s structure, it doesn’t just sit on the surface. It seeps into drywall, insulation, wood framing, and even concrete. Simply mopping up visible water isn’t enough; you need a professional approach to draw out that hidden dampness. Our process is designed to be thorough, efficient, and to get your home back to its normal humidity levels quickly. Cutting corners here can lead to a host of problems down the line, from mold infestations to weakened structural components. We make sure every bit of moisture is accounted for.

Inspection and Assessment

First, we’ll thoroughly inspect the affected areas using specialized tools like moisture meters and infrared cameras. This helps us pinpoint exactly where the water has penetrated and how deeply. We’ll create a detailed plan based on our findings, ensuring we tackle the problem at its source. Identifying all wet materials is our top priority.

Water Extraction

Once we’ve assessed the situation, we begin removing as much standing water as possible using powerful extraction equipment. While this might seem obvious, it’s a critical first step to stop the damage from spreading. We’ll get the bulk of the water out so we can focus on the hidden moisture. Removing standing water is essential.

Drying and Dehumidification

This is where the real structural drying happens. We strategically place industrial-strength air movers and dehumidifiers throughout your property. These machines work tirelessly to accelerate the evaporation process and pull moisture out of the air and building materials. It’s a carefully controlled environment designed to dry your home safely. Accelerating evaporation is key.

Monitoring and Testing

Throughout the drying process, our technicians will regularly monitor humidity levels and moisture content in various materials. We use advanced moisture meters to track our progress and ensure we’re reaching the desired dry standard. We won’t pack up until we’re certain your home is properly dried. Tracking moisture levels confirms success.

Warning Signs You Need Structural Drying Services

Even if you don’t see a flood, there are subtle signs that water might be wreaking havoc inside your walls. Catching these early can save you a lot of headaches and money. Ignoring them can lead to bigger, more expensive problems down the road. Pay attention to what your home is telling you.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

That persistent, damp, earthy smell is often the first indicator of hidden moisture. It means mold or mildew may be starting to grow in dark, damp areas. Investigating strange smells is important.

Discolored Walls or Ceilings

Water stains, yellow or brown splotches on your walls or ceiling, are a clear sign that water has penetrated the surface. These spots can worsen over time. Addressing water spots prevents spread.

Peeling or Bubbling Paint/Wallpaper

When moisture gets behind paint or wallpaper, it can cause it to lose its adhesion, leading to peeling or bubbling. This indicates water damage beneath the surface. Repairing peeling paint needs a dry substrate.

Warped or Sagging Floors/Walls

Wood materials absorb water and can swell, leading to floors that feel soft or look uneven, or walls that appear to be bowing. This is a serious sign of structural compromise. Fixing warped materials requires professional attention.

Increased Humidity Levels

If your home suddenly feels much more humid than usual, even with air conditioning running, there might be an unseen moisture source. Reducing indoor humidity is vital.

Condensation on Windows or Pipes

Excessive condensation can be a symptom of high indoor humidity caused by trapped moisture within your home’s structure. Managing condensation prevents related issues.

Structural Drying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or condensation on a cold pipe Yes No Easily wiped away and the cause can often be fixed with insulation.
Small puddle from a spilled glass of water Yes No Wipe it up, dry the surface, and use a fan.
Water stain on a ceiling from a minor roof leak Maybe Yes You can clean the stain, but the underlying leak needs professional repair to prevent further structural issues.
Leak from a plumbing fixture causing dampness behind a wall No Yes You can’t access the hidden moisture, and it will likely lead to mold and structural rot.
After a significant storm or burst pipe affecting multiple rooms No Yes The scale of the water intrusion requires specialized equipment and expertise to dry thoroughly.
Suspected mold growth or musty odors without visible water No Yes Hidden moisture is likely present, requiring professional assessment and drying to eradicate the problem.

While tackling small, surface-level water issues yourself is sometimes possible, it’s crucial to know your limits. When water gets into your home’s structure, it demands a professional approach. Professional intervention is key for thorough drying and preventing long-term damage.

Structural Drying Services Cost In Davie, FL

The cost for structural drying services in Davie, FL, can vary quite a bit. It really depends on how widespread the water damage is, how deep it has penetrated your home’s materials, and how long the area has been wet. These are estimates, and a proper assessment is always needed for an exact quote. Understanding drying costs helps you plan.

Service Aspect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Inspection & Moisture Assessment $250 – $750 Size of affected area and complexity of the intrusion.
Water Extraction (for moderate intrusion) $500 – $2,000 Volume of water to be removed and accessibility of the area.
Industrial Air Mover Rental (per unit, per day) $20 – $50 Number of units required and duration of drying needed.
Industrial Dehumidifier Rental (per unit, per day) $50 – $150 Type of dehumidifier and the amount of moisture to be extracted.
Moisture Monitoring & Testing $300 – $1,000 (integrated into overall service) Frequency of testing and reporting requirements.
Specialized Drying (e.g., under subflooring) $1,000 – $5,000+ Complexity of the access and the materials involved.

Common Questions About Structural Drying Services

How long does structural drying usually take?

The drying timeline can vary significantly, typically ranging from three days to two weeks, depending on the severity of the water damage, the types of materials affected, and ambient humidity. Our team uses advanced monitoring to expedite the process safely and efficiently. We aim for quick, thorough drying.

Will my insurance cover structural drying services?

In most cases, yes, if the water damage is from a covered peril like a burst pipe or storm damage. We work closely with insurance adjusters to ensure proper documentation and billing. You can be confident that we handle insurance claims smoothly. It’s always best to check your specific policy details.

What are the health risks of not drying properly?

Failing to dry a structure completely can lead to serious health issues, primarily from mold and mildew growth. These can cause respiratory problems, allergic reactions, and other health complications. Preventing mold growth is a primary goal of our service. We ensure your home is safe.

What kind of equipment do you use for structural drying?

We utilize professional-grade equipment, including high-speed air movers to increase airflow and evaporation, powerful dehumidifiers to remove moisture from the air, and specialized moisture meters and infrared cameras to detect hidden water. This advanced technology allows for effective moisture extraction and monitoring. It’s far beyond typical home fans.

Can I prevent structural drying issues in my home?

Regular maintenance is key. This includes inspecting plumbing for leaks, ensuring your roof and windows are properly sealed, and maintaining your HVAC system to control indoor humidity. Knowing the warning signs of water intrusion can also help you act fast. Prompt attention to small issues prevents bigger problems.
